Abstract

Perkembangan pesat generative artificial intelligence (AI) telah menciptakan paradigma baru dalam penciptaan konten digital sekaligus menghadirkan tantangan kompleks bagi perlindungan hak cipta. Penelitian ini bertujuan mengeksplorasi model perlindungan hak cipta digital berbasis blockchain pada era generative AI melalui integrasi Non-Fungible Token (NFT) dan smart contract. Dengan pendekatan kualitatif berbasis kajian pustaka sistematis dan analisis doktrinal-normatif, penelitian ini mensintesis temuan tahun 2021–2025. Populasi terdiri atas regulasi, dokumen kebijakan, dan artikel ilmiah bereputasi tentang hak cipta dan generative AI, dengan sampel purposif berdasarkan relevansi. Data dikumpulkan menggunakan protokol telaah dokumen dan dianalisis secara tematik mengikuti kerangka Braun dan Clarke. Hasil penelitian menunjukkan blockchain mampu menghadirkan perlindungan hak cipta yang otomatis, transparan, dan tahan manipulasi, dengan integrasi NFT dan smart contract mendukung registrasi, lisensi, dan penegakan yang efisien. Kesimpulan menegaskan potensi blockchain sebagai fondasi perlindungan hak cipta digital, meski diperlukan uji empiris dan harmonisasi regulasi lebih lanjut.
